Merchant's description
Château Bourgneuf 2018 is a full-bodied Bordeaux red wine produced in the Pomerol appellation on Bordeaux`s right bank. Château Bourgneuf is a well-appointed property on the western edge of Pomerol, with of vineyards on gravelly clay soil. The property`s 2018 is a blend of 80% Merlot and 20% Cabernet Franc and offers mouth-coating, ripe black fruits, with notes of cedar and mocha on a supple, broad palate.
